Subject to the direction of the Board of Directors, the Treasurer shall: valuable documents of the Corporation. other governmental agencies. cause regular audits of the Corporation’s financial records to be made; WebYour treasurer works with the organization's bookkeeper and other staff to focus on money matters. The treasurer ensures that reporting is accurate and that the board has the information it needs to make good decisions. The treasurer often chairs the finance committee and works with an auditor.

WebApr 23, 2012 · As soon as the organization hires staff, it should check the bylaws and verify whether the roles of board members and officers need to be redefined. Particularly the role of the treasurer often needs readjustment. Internal controls. When setting up a system of internal controls, here are some guidelines: Segregation of duties.
